Richard V. Silver AXA Equitable Life Insurance Company, a leading innovator in life insurance and retirement savings products, announced four new executive appointments.

The board elected Andrew McMahon as president of its Financial Protection and Wealth Management business, James Shepherdson as president of its Retirement Savings business, and Richard V. Silver as chief administrative officer and chief legal officer. The three executives, along with Richard Dziadzio, chief financial officer, were also elected as senior executive vice presidents of AXA Equitable. All four, previously executive vice presidents, will continue to report to Christopher M. “Kip” Condron, chairman and chief executive officer of AXA Equitable.

Mr. Silver will oversee Information Technology; Central Marketing, Innovation and Communications; External Affairs; and the Strategic Initiatives Group. He will continue to be responsible for the Law Department and the Funds Management Group.

Mr. Silver joined AXA Equitable as an attorney in 1986. From 1991 through 1994, he was president and chief operating officer of AXA Advisors. He returned to the Law Department in 1995 and held a series of management positions, becoming general counsel of AXA Equitable in 1999 and executive vice president and general counsel of AXA Financial in 2001. Before joining AXA Equitable, Mr. Silver was a vice president and senior securities attorney with a subsidiary of Merrill Lynch. He began his career at the law firm of Cahill Gordon & Reindel. Mr. Silver earned a B.A. in government from St. John’s University and a J.D. from St. John’s University Law School.
